**Ticket: StormCrier fan-out duplicates alerts in the Pellworth region**

When two overlapping advisories land within the same debounce window, the fan-out worker sends both instead of merging — folks got four pings for one hailstorm. Probably the dedupe key ignores polygon overlap. Repro is flaky, so future maintainers: start from the worker build tagged with the token below.

trace token, fafog-kageg: htk4_98e6

## Runbook: ParcelPing Webhook Failures

When the parcel-tracking webhook stops delivering, first check the Driftmoor relay dashboard for a backlog above 500 events. Retries are automatic for 15 minutes; after that, events land in the dead-letter store and must be replayed manually with the replay tool. Confirm the carrier feed is up before replaying, or you'll double-send. The current production configuration for the webhook consumer is listed below for reference.

settings of yaguf-bahip:
druwyn:
  log_level: debug
  metrics_host: metrics.druwyn.qorvelsys.internal
  pool_size: 32

Ticket: Evacuation-chair store, Stairwell B, Larkspur House. Contractor attendance required to inspect and service both chairs this week. The store is kept locked at all times; please relock it immediately after the inspection and note any defects on the ticket. To open the store cabinet, use the keypad code below.

turnstile pass: bdg-FVNQRS-72965873

## Environments: Glimmerfeed telemetry compression

Glimmerfeed compresses telemetry payloads with zstd before shipping to the Harrowdale aggregators. Staging runs compression level 6; production runs level 3 to keep CPU headroom on ingest nodes. Payloads under 1 KB skip compression entirely. The next release enables dictionary training, so expect a one-time ratio dip during warmup. Each environment's ingest tier currently runs with the configuration values below.

service settings:
[silwyn]
host = silwyn.crelvogrid.internal
user = silwyn_svc
database = silwyn_prod